Apps close self

I cannot open itunes or app store on my iphone 4.  Also, mail closes itself when I try to open the emails.  I have tried turning the phone off/on, installing the latest update, off/on again.  Deleting my mail accounts and adding them back on did not help.  If they were not the original app I would uninstall them and reinstall them but I can't.
Any Ideas?
Thank you in advance.

Try logging out ang back in to your iTunes account... Settings > Store
Try downloading any free app to resync your iTunes account.
Regarding your email, you might have a corrupt email in your inbox.  Access your mail from your computer and clean out your inbox.  Then try again with your iPhone.

  • Email not opening This is a sudden thing, Email had been working fine for two months then today would not stay open now it will not open at all. after trying to open mail I receive a white screen for a nano second and the app closes

    Email not opening on my iPad2 This is a sudden thing, email had been working fine since purchasing the device then today would not stay open,  now it will not open at all. After trying to open mail I receive a white screen for a nano second and the app closes.

    Have you tried closing the Mail app completely ? From the home screen (i.e. not with Mail 'open' on-screen) double-click the home button to bring up the taskbar, then press and hold any of the apps on the taskbar for a couple of seconds or so until they start shaking, then press the '-' in the top left of the Mail app to close it, and touch any part of the screen above the taskbar so as to stop the shaking and close the taskbar.
    If that doesn't work then you could try a reset : press and hold both the sleep and home buttons for about 10 to 15 seconds (ignore the red slider), after which the Apple logo should appear - you won't lose any content, it's the iPad equivalent of a reboot.

  • Why do apps close immediately after opening?

    I updated to iOS 4.3.3 on my iPad, now my apps close immediately after I open them.
    Built-in apps are OK, but all my added apps no longer run!
    Help!
    I have rebooted using the sleep button held down for 10 seconds.   No joy.
    Now, I was advised to hold down sleep button and home circle button at same time and disregard the red bar... this reboots to Apple circle, but still apps close really fast after I try to open them.
    This actually started several hours after my update, not right away, but that is all that changed.
    Very frustrating!

    Jeanne ... You answered my post in a totally different thread but I did read it. If the problem is in the OS, why do the built in Apple apps not cause the iPad to crash? That reasoning makes no sense to me. Did you try closing all of the apps like I suggested and then restart?
    Another way to approach this is to remove all of the apps from your iPad. Do this by removing them when you sync. Simply uncheck all of the non Apple apps and sync. Then - one or two apps at a time- add them back on to the iPad by resyncing. Use those one or two apps and see if they crash. If they don't crash, add one or two more apps and try those. Keep repeating the process until the iPad starts to crash again. You should be able to narrow down which app is causing the problem.
    Are you sure that all of these apps are compatible with 4.3.3. as well? Check in the app store and make sure that they are.

  • Once I multitask, the app closes! HELP :(

    This has been going on for quiet a bit of time.
    Whenever I open an app, facebook for example, it would work fine. Then when I switch to something else or the home menu, the app closes. How do I know? Because when I go to switch back to the app it's reopenning. It happens with most social networking apps, such as Facebook, Facebook Messenger, Whats App, and Skype.
    Here's some proof;
    I open up my facebook on my phone, and as usual, I have a green dot next to me on a friends chat that shows that I'm online:
    And now when I go back to the home menu, the app should still be running, and it should show a mobile icon next to my name that says I'm avalible on mobile. Instead, it just says I went totally offline! So the app just closed on its own...

    Mulititasking on an iOS device is more like a pause feature that allows you to switch apps quickly and pickup where you left off. Most app don't actually stay running. Here's how Apple describes it from their support page on the subjuct.
    "Double-clicking the Home button displays a list of recently used apps. These apps are not necessarily actively in use, open, or taking up system resources. They will instantly launch when you return to them. Certain tasks or services can continue to run in the background."
